Addressing both physical and mathematical aspects, this self-contained text on boundary value problems is geared toward advanced undergraduates and graduate students in mathematics. Prerequisites include some familiarity with multidimensional calculus and ordinary differential equations.
A brief introductory section precedes the two-part treatment, which begins with coverage of basic theory. Topics include Fourier series of periodic functions, linear boundary value problems, diffusion problems related to the heat equation, steady-state problems involving the potential equation, and propagation problems incorporating the wave equation. The second part focuses on extensions, exploring general second-order linear equations and systems, series methods, integral transform methods, and Sturm-Liouville problems. Problem sets appear throughout the text, along with a substantial section of answers to selected problems. This corrected edition includes a new Preface and an updated Appendix.

John L. Troutman is Professor Emeritus of Mathematics, Syracuse University. Maurino Bautista is Professor of Mathematics, Rochester Instititue of Technology.
